The benefits of blueberries

blueberries

Blueberries are  a powerful source of antioxidants, fiber and essential minerals. They have been proven to prevent and reduce various diseases.

Their antibacterial properties are used, among other things, to treat urinary tract infections and neutralize the growth of bacteria.

Their cleansing properties support liver functions. At the same time, they help prevent diseases such as fatty liver or liver cirrhosis.

Among the nutrients in blueberries we find:

  • Vitamins (A, C and E)
  • Dietary fiber
  • Minerals (potassium, iron and calcium)
  • Tannins

The benefits of red beets

Beetroot

Beetroot is one of the vegetables most often used  for cleansing your liver and blood. 

He is known for his culinary possibilities. It is an organic source of essential nutrients that gives your body many benefits when you add it to your diet.

It has a high content of antioxidants and fiber. Both are very important to optimize  the cleaning process of the body organs. 

They also provide protective effects against damage caused by free radicals. This damage takes place in the cells.

Beets also provide interesting amounts of betalain, betacyanins and folic acid. These are all important to keep your liver healthy.

Its concentration of pectin, a certain type of fiber,  helps control excess cholesterol. It also helps with the digestion of fats. 

It gives you nutrients like:

  • Vitamins (A, B complex and C)
  • Minerals (Phosphorus, Zinc, Potassium, Iron and Calcium)
  • Amino acids

Ingredients

  • 3 small red beets
  • 1/2 cup blueberries
  • 1 squeezed lemon
  • 4 cups cold water

Preparation

  • First wash the beetroot well and squeeze it into a natural juice.
  • Add the juice to the blender. Then add the blueberries, lemon juice and water as well.
  • Mix all ingredients together until you have a smooth texture, without lumps.
  • Drink both a glass before breakfast and another glass in the afternoon.
